Apple India revenue set to cross Rs 1.4 lakh crore in FY26, eyeing HUL and Samsung

Kotak MF projects Apple India FY26 revenue above Rs 1.4 lakh crore, a 6.2x jump from Rs 22,845 crore in FY21. Premiumisation, iPhone 17 demand and EMI-led accessibility drove 14 million iPhone shipments in 2025, up 16% YoY, taking 9% smartphone share in Q1.
